RRB Ministerial and Isolated Categories selection process includes three stages: a Computer-Based Test (CBT), a Skill Test (post specific), and Document Verification & Medical Examination. The CBT will be for 100 marks with a duration of 90 minutes. It is crucial to complete the syllabus well before the exam for ample revision time. | Section | No. of Questions | Maximum Marks | Duration |
| Professional Ability | 50 | 50 | 90 Minutes 120 Minutes (PwBD Candidates) |
| General Awareness | 15 | 15 | |
| General Intelligence and Reasoning | 15 | 15 | |
| Mathematics | 10 | 10 | |
| General Science | 10 | 10 | |
| Total | 100 | 100 | |
The skill exam will be conducted according to their job description. Tests cover stenography, translation, performance, and teaching skills.
Candidates who pass the computer-based written exam are qualified to participate in the stenographer skill test. The Railway Recruitment Board (RRB) will shortlist 10 times the total number of applications for the Shorthand Exam, or SST. To qualify for the Stenography Skill Test, applicants must satisfy the following criteria:
| Stenography Skill Test | ||
| Type of Stenographer | Words Per Minute (WPM) | Transcription Time |
| English | 80 WPM | 50 minutes |
| Hindi | 80 WPM | 65 minutes |
